WorkReady data is tamper-proof by design. Every measurement is cryptographically protected from capture to cloud.
Every sync request is signed with a secret key. Forged or modified data is rejected by the server.
Each record in the local database has an HMAC tag. If anyone edits the SQLite file, the tamper is detected.
Signatures are time-bound. The server rejects payloads older than 5 minutes to prevent replay attacks.
All data comes from automated speed tests and OS-level telemetry. Users can't manually enter or override values.
Config and database files are locked to the current OS user. Other processes on the machine can't read them.
Pydantic schemas enforce range limits on all fields. Network types are validated against an allowed enum.

A lightweight background agent runs automated speed tests every 30 minutes. It measures real-world download, upload, latency, jitter, and packet loss. Every result is cryptographically signed (HMAC-SHA256), so employers see verified telemetry instead of self-reported numbers or a one-time screenshot.
For most professional remote roles, aim for sustained download speeds of 25 to 50 Mbps, upload of 10+ Mbps, and latency under 60 ms. WorkReady weights consistency over peak speed, so a stable 20 Mbps line beats a flaky 200 Mbps line for video calls and async work.
